What was feudalism?
A system of mutual obligation and rewards
What did the King give and get in feudalism?
The King gave land to the nobles

The King received allegiance, knights and taxes from the nobles

What did the nobles get and give in feudalism?
The nobles gave the knights land

The nobles received loyalty and taxes from the knights

What did the knights give and get in feudalism?
The knights gave land and protection to the peasants

They received food, taxes and work on their land from the peasants

What did the peasants give and get in feudalism?
The peasants gave food, taxes and their services to knights

They received land and protection from the knights

What was the church's role in governing?
Very wealthy- collected tithes, didn't pay tax



Everyone believed in heaven and hell- did what the church said

What was the church's role in religion?
Conducted weekly services

Told people how to behave and what was right and wrong


In charge of praying to protect people

what was the church's role in the social system?
Centre for learning

ran schools and hospitals

Employed peasants

Cared for sick, travellers, very poor


Lots of social life
